Subject: Key rotation for InvoiceForge renderer

Welcome, new folks. Every quarter we rotate the credential the Pellworth PDF invoice renderer uses to call our internal asset service, Vaultline. The old key stops working Friday at noon. Update your local .env and the staging config before then, and verify a test invoice renders with the new embedded fonts. For convenience, the freshly issued key is included here.

app token of bagef-bageg = kto11_vuwA0uhrEMg

## Step 7: Enable banker's rounding in Coinwright

This step addresses the accumulated rounding drift reported in cross-currency settlements. Coinwright previously truncated conversion results at four decimal places, which biased totals downward over high-volume batches. The new build applies half-even rounding at six places before aggregation. Please review the diff against the old behavior, then confirm the service boots with the following configuration.

service settings:
druael:
  pin: 7528
  metrics_host: metrics.druael.lumiclabs.internal
  tenant: wendor
  seal: seal_c765840a

Ticket CLI-0883: tailgrab misconfigured for plugin sandboxes

Hey plugin folks — if your tailgrab plugin is hanging on `tailgrab follow`, it's not you, it's us. The sandbox image shipped with an env file pointing at the retired Brimford log cluster, so streams just stall. Quick fix until the next image drops: edit ~/.tailgrab/.env, change LOG_CLUSTER to the new Orvane endpoint, set TAIL_BUFFER=4096, and then paste your personal stream access secret on the very next line.

sealed setting: ARCHIVE_KEY3=8d0